Hervé 2,053 Posted May 9, 2020 Share Posted May 9, 2020 MacBook6,1 were usually fitted with a Broadcom BCM43224 card (14e4:4353) and that's still natively supported in Catalina. Check your IOReg with IORegistryExplorer app and look for ARPT device. Save the IOReg and post a zipped copy if you have trouble on that front. Link to post Share on other sites
